Pular para o conteúdo

Sed - duplicando linhas

Dica publicada em Linux / Comandos
Mauricio Ferrari (LinuxProativo) maurixnovatrento
Hits: 3.463 Categoria: Linux Subcategoria: Comandos
  • Indicar
  • Impressora
  • Denunciar
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.

Sed - duplicando linhas

O sed tem um recurso muito interessante que tem a função de duplicar as linhas de um determinado arquivo de texto. Vamos usar esse exemplo:
Linux: Sed - Duplicando linhas
O parâmetro que faz a mágica é o 'p'. Veja como é simples duplicar apenas a primeira linha:
Linux: Sed - Duplicando linhas
O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.
Ok. E para duplicar a última linha? É muito simples, para isso vamos usar o '$', que tem a função de mapear a última linha. Veja na prática:
Linux: Sed - Duplicando linhas
Também pode ser feito isso:
Linux: Sed - Duplicando linhas
E por fim, com o exemplo recriado, o 'p' usado individualmente duplica todas as linhas:
Linux: Sed - Duplicando linhas
Simples assim. Espero que seja útil. Até a próxima.

O Viva o Linux depende da receita de anúncios para se manter. Ative os cookies aqui para nos patrocinar.
Não conseguimos carregar os anúncios. Se usa bloqueador, considere liberar o Viva o Linux para nos patrocinar.

Avidemux não abre no Salix 14.2 [Resolvido]

Restaurando o .bashrc e o .profile para o padrão no Ubuntu e derivados

dvd::rip no Linux Mint 20 na gambiarra

Renomeando em massa sem precisar instalar comandos adicionais

Extensão do Google Chrome para Notificação de E-mail do Google

tasksel: aptitude failed (100) [Resolvido]

Acessando o início e fim de um histórico extenso no terminal

Como Criar e Aplicar um Patch de Correção de Código

Timeout para terminais

O comando join

Nenhum comentário foi encontrado.

Contribuir com comentário

Entre na sua conta para comentar.